Output 8f72b7242248e86eb08d2f179904ce4a40a415d89ebffe6bbafd1884e67c148a:1

value
1592427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c2d320475ce20a314ffb38979e86db95d217920 OP_EQUAL
address
3QgQM7dVWAiYp3XNmKzswP6rS84i8JawBf
transaction
8f72b7242248e86eb08d2f179904ce4a40a415d89ebffe6bbafd1884e67c148a
confirmations
386848
spent
true